Best coffee spots in Santorini
Mati Art Gallery & Café
A caldera-view cafe in Imerovigli with a peaceful terrace and excellent Greek coffee. The gallery sells local art and the views across to the volcanic islands are stunning. Less crowded than Oia spots.
Passaggio Coffee Bar
In Fira with good espresso and a terrace overlooking the caldera. It's more affordable than the famous sunset restaurants and the coffee is better. The freddo espresso is perfect for hot days.
Coffee Island
A Greek chain with a Fira location serving reliable specialty coffee. The freddo cappuccino (cold, foamy Greek-style) is the best way to cool down. The quality is above average for the price.
Melenio Café
A modern cafe in Fira with specialty coffee and light bites. The flat white is well-made and the pastries are fresh. Good WiFi and air conditioning — a practical escape from the heat and crowds.
Aktaion Café
On the main square in Oia, this traditional cafe serves Greek coffee and fresh pastries with views of passing tourists and the whitewashed architecture. The baklava is homemade and excellent.
Vitrin Café
A cute cafe in Fira near the cable car station with good espresso and homemade cakes. The lemon cake and the iced coffee are both excellent. A reliable mid-exploration caffeine stop.
Ermis Café
A small cafe in Pyrgos village with a castle-view terrace. The Greek frappe is strong and frothy, and the orange cake is traditional and delicious. The peaceful village setting is a world away from Fira.
Skiza Café
A hip cafe in Fira with a minimalist interior and good specialty coffee. The cold brew is smooth and the breakfast options are solid. Popular with younger visitors looking for quality coffee.
